How to Confirm Your Event

Confirming your event is the necessary step to set up promo codes and presale codes, and for eventually opening sales. Confirming is the way to say "yes, I've reviewed my event details, and they are correct".
Alert
Once an event is confirmed, the seating chart cannot be changed. 

      1. Log in and navigate to your department. 
      2.  Under the Box Office section header, click EVENTS. 
      3. Click EVENT MANAGER next to your event. 
      4. Click EVENT INFORMATION from the top navigation bar. 
      5. Review that the information is correct. 
      6. Click CONFIRM NOW.


      7. In the popup, check the check box and click CONFIRM NOW
      

And you're done! You can now set up any necessary related items like discounts. 

If you are ready to open sales to the general public, you can also set sales to public now.
